A multi-panel altarpiece with a central scene featuring a figure on a cross is set within an ornate gold frame. The central panel depicts a pale-skinned figure on a wooden cross, wearing a white loincloth. Red liquid drips from the figure's hands, feet, and side. Above the figure's head, a white banner reads "INRI" in red letters, and a white bird hovers at the very top. Four small, winged figures, two on each side, float near the central figure's body, holding small chalices to catch the dripping red liquid. Below the cross, a crowd of figures gathers. On the left, a group of women, some with halos, are depicted with varied expressions and postures; one woman in a dark blue robe is embraced by others in pink and red garments. On the right, a group of men, some bearded and wearing hats or crowns, look towards the central figure. One man in a blue robe and red hat raises his right arm towards the central figure. A woman in a long red dress kneels at the base of the cross, looking upwards. The central scene is flanked by two vertical columns, each containing three smaller arched panels. The left column features three figures, all with halos and dressed in red or orange robes, with various hand gestures. The right column also contains three figures with halos; the top and bottom figures wear blue robes with hands clasped in prayer, while the middle figure wears a gold and white robe, also with hands clasped. The entire background of the altarpiece is a shimmering gold.
